[PATCH V3 0/5] ARM: dts: bcm2835: Add Raspberry Pi Zero

Stefan Wahren [off-list ref] writes:
This patch series add support for Raspberry Pi Zero with USB host mode. It's
based on the patch "ARM64: dts: bcm: Use a symlink to R-Pi dtsi files
from arch=arm" from Ian Campbell. Currently there is a bug [1] which needs
to fixed before because after applying these patch series the bug isn't
reproducible anymore but not fixed.

The patches 1-3 fixes the USB DT settings for bcm283x. Patch 3 is only compile
tested, so it would be nice if someone with a RPi 3 could test it.
The last patch based on the work of Lubomir Rintel [2] and Noralf Tr?nnes [3].

Note: Patch 3 can't be cherry-picked because it depends on Patch 2.
Pulled this series minus the arm64 patch to bcm2835-dt-next.  My Pi3
setup is down currently so I wasn't able to test it.
